Wacom goes wireless with Intuos4 pen tablet

Wacom has jumped aboard the Bluetooth bandwagon with their new Bluetooth Wireless Intuos4 pen tablet that is capable of communicating reliable within a 10 meter radius. This provides users with enough freedom to move about the room and work in their comfort zone without being confined to a cubicle. Too bad there is only one size to choose from – medium, but thank goodness the asymmetrical design that looks pleasing to the eyes. It is worthwhile to note that the Wacom Touch Ring and the customizable ExpressKeys are on one side of the tablet, making them accessible to the user’s non-dominant hand. The Intuos4 will play nice with a host of creativity software including Adobe Photoshop, Adobe Illustrator and Corel Painter, where it will hit the market this March for £359.99.
